CollegeExplain it at college levelState the model precisely

This tool models one operating decision from explicitly supplied company assumptions. The implemented relation is Equipment cost per productive hour = annual ownership and operating cost ÷ productive hours, evaluated from Annual depreciation and financing cost, Annual maintenance and repair cost, Annual fuel, charging and insurance cost, Annual productive equipment hours, Annual downtime hours to produce Landscape equipment cost per productive hour. Residual value, financing, downtime, transport and operator labor should be modeled separately. The model omits unentered taxes, cash timing, legal constraints and market uncertainty. Compare the output with company records and a downside scenario before committing resources.

Inputs and operating assumptions

This model uses Annual depreciation and financing cost, Annual maintenance and repair cost, Annual fuel, charging and insurance cost, Annual productive equipment hours, Annual downtime hours. Keep currencies, accounting treatment and time periods consistent with one another.

The formula

Equipment cost per productive hour = annual ownership and operating cost ÷ productive hours

What the calculator produces

The primary output is Landscape equipment cost per productive hour; it also exposes Annual equipment ownership and operating cost, Equipment productive availability. Change one assumption at a time so the comparison remains explainable.

Before using the result in a decision

This compact model cannot capture every tax, accounting, legal, market or operational condition. Compare the output with current company records, cash timing and the downside scenario before committing resources.
